Answer:

The answer is 10.2

Step-by-step explanation:

This question wants you to use the Pythagorean Theorem

The Pythagorean Theorem is A^2+B^2=C^2

In this case you can substitute A for 11 and C for 15

If you do some algebra and make the equation B^2=C^2-A^2 or B^2=15^2-11^2

You can simplify and solve now.

B^2=225-121

B^2=104

B=[tex]\sqrt{104}[/tex]
